What is a Toto Site?

A Toto site is an online platform that allows users to place bets on various outcomes, most commonly:

  • Sports match results (football, basketball, etc.)
  • Lottery numbers or random draws
  • Prediction-based games
  • Jackpot or pool betting systems

The word “Toto” is often associated with “totalizator” systems, which are betting pools where all wagers are combined, and winnings are distributed among successful participants after deductions.


How Toto Sites Work

Toto platforms generally operate using a pool-based betting system:

  1. User Registration
    Users create an account on the platform and may need to verify their identity.
  2. Deposit Funds
    Players add money using supported payment methods such as bank transfer, e-wallets, or cryptocurrencies (depending on the platform).
  3. Place Bets or Predictions
    Users select outcomes they believe will occur, such as match winners or score predictions.
  4. Pooling System
    All bets are collected into a central pool.
  5. Result Calculation
    After the event concludes, winnings are calculated based on correct predictions and divided among winners.

Legal Status of Toto Sites

The legality of Toto sites depends entirely on jurisdiction:

  • In some countries, regulated betting platforms are allowed under strict licensing laws.
  • In others, online gambling is partially restricted or fully banned.
  • Many Toto sites operate in offshore jurisdictions, which may not follow local regulations.

Users should always understand their local laws before engaging with any betting platform.


Risks and Concerns

While Toto sites may appear entertaining, they carry serious risks:

1. Financial Loss

Gambling is inherently risky, and most users lose more money than they win over time.

2. Addiction Potential

The reward-based system can lead to compulsive behavior and addiction.

3. Fraudulent Platforms

Some Toto sites are unregulated and may:

  • Delay or refuse withdrawals
  • Manipulate outcomes
  • Disappear after collecting funds

4. Lack of Legal Protection

Users in unregulated markets often have no legal recourse in case of disputes.
